## Formula sandbox tuning

User-supplied formulas in Gridmoor execute inside a restricted interpreter with hard ceilings on time, memory, and call depth. Reviewers should confirm any change to these ceilings is justified in the PR description, since raising them widens the abuse surface. Defaults were chosen from production traces. The current limits are as follows.

limits module of tafog-fawip:
WEIGHTS = {
    "julix": 57,
    "lamys": 992,
    "kasvan": 209,
    "quenok": 750,
    "alddor": 259,
    "oliath": 1009,
    "wenix": 815,
}

Subject: Quickstore 4.2 — bloom filter now fronts the KV layer

Plugin authors: starting with this release, Quickstore places a bloom filter ahead of the key-value store. Negative lookups return faster; false positives fall through safely. No API changes are required on your side. Verify your plugin against the staging build referenced below.

session token of fahif-tadup = htk3_9c7

**Action item 4 (owner: incoming contractor):** Add validation to the Moonrake tide-table widget so that predictions are rejected when the upstream Harrowick gauge feed reports a stale timestamp older than six hours. During the incident, stale data rendered as current tides, misleading users at Pelling Cove. Acceptance criteria and test fixtures are documented on the internal page.

runbook for kageg-yafof: https://jira.norvalabs.test/board/view/secrets/job/ticket/board/board/2bc6c981aafb1e8fe00a8459

Heads of department: Quillford Instruments proposes transferring tier-one customer support to an external provider, Merrowdale Services, over two phases. Phase one covers email and chat queues; phase two covers telephone support after a quality gate. Internal staff move to tier-two escalation roles, with retraining funded centrally. Service-level targets remain unchanged during transition, and a rollback clause applies for the first six months. The confidential commercial rationale is recorded immediately below.

internal memo for kawip-hadug: Headcount on the Wenwyn team goes from 7 to 140 by the end of January. Gross margin on Wenwyn came in at 20 percent against a plan of 15 percent.